Leather accessories boost exports
25/01/2008
sector exports increased by 10.92% in the first four months of the current financial year (July 2007 to October 2007) to reach $136.35 million, up from $122.93 million in the same period of the prior year.
Finished leather exports crept 2.72% higher to reach $85.06 million, up from $82.81 million; leather footwear exports shot up 20.05% to $47.79 million from $39.81 million; while leather bag and purse exports soared a massive 1,029.03% to reach $ 3.5 million, up from $0.31 million in corresponding period last year.
